Two young activists from our WIMPS (Where Is My Public Servant?) project are heading to Westminster to attend a reception at Downing Street to celebrate winners of the Prime Minister’s ‘Big Society Awards’.
Four members of the WIMPS Crew have been selected for an award by the Attorney General of the UK! Una Crossen, Shauneen Conlon, Karen Devlin and Aoibheann Fitzpatrick – all students at St Dominic’s College in Belfast entered the competition by creating and submitting a video highlighting many of the issues faced by young people.
